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of an existing roofing system to identify potential issues before they develop into costly repairs or replacements. These inspections typ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age, such as cracks, blisters, or missing shingles, as well as checking the condition of flashing, vents, and other roof components. Inspectors may also evaluate the drainage systems and look for areas where water could pool or seep through, ensuring the roof maintains its protective qualities. Regular inspections are essential for maintaining the integrity of the roof and prolonging its lifespan, especially in regions with variable weather conditions.

One of the primary benefits of asphalt roof inspections is their ability to detect problems early, preventing minor issues from escalating into major repairs or complete roof failures. Common problems identified during inspections include damaged or missing shingles, deteriorated flashing, ponding water, and areas of wear caused by weather exposure or aging materials. By catching these issues early, property owners can schedule necessary repairs with local service providers, potentially saving money and avoiding the inconvenience of emergency roof failures. Inspections also help verify that the roof remains compliant with any local building codes or warranty requirements.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for an asphalt roof inspection 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ge higher for detailed assessments or older roofs. Prices can vary based on local market conditions.

Service Fees - Basic asphalt roof inspections generally cost between $100 and $200 for standard residential properties. Additional charges may apply for extensive or specialized inspections. Costs are subject to regional differences and contractor pricing.

Inspection Frequency - Routine inspections are often recommended every 3 to 5 years, with costs averaging around $150 per visit. More frequent inspections might be needed for roofs in harsh climates or with prior damage, influencing overall costs.

Additional Services - Some providers include minor repairs or detailed reports as part of the inspection fee, which can range from $200 to $400. Extra services are billed separately and vary by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should an asphalt roof be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ended at least once a year and after severe weather events to identify potential issues early.

What are common signs of asphalt roof damage? Signs include missing or cracked shingles, granule loss, water stains on ceilings, and visible sagging or curling edges.

Why is a roof inspection important? An inspection helps detect damage or deterioration that could lead to leaks or costly repairs if left unaddressed.

What does an asphalt roof inspection typically include? It generally involves checking for damaged shingles, inspecting flashing and vents, and assessing overall roof condition.
